A seat cowl is a motorcycle accessory designed to replace the pillion seat, offering a streamlined and sportier aesthetic. For the BMW S1000RR, this component typically matches the motorcycle’s factory paint and integrates seamlessly with the existing bodywork. This accessory generally installs using the same mounting points as the original passenger seat.
The addition of this element enhances the visual appeal of the motorcycle by creating a solo-seat configuration. This modification often improves aerodynamic efficiency, particularly at higher speeds, by reducing drag. Historically, this accessory has been popular among riders seeking a more aggressive look and improved performance on the track or during solo rides.

3. Material Composition
The choice of materials in the construction of a component dictates not only its longevity but also its performance characteristics. For the BMW S1000RR seat cowl, this selection represents a pivotal decision that balances weight, durability, and aesthetic appeal.
-
ABS Plastic: The Common Foundation
Acrylonitrile Butadiene Styrene (ABS) plastic serves as the workhorse material for many aftermarket components. Its relatively low cost, ease of molding, and acceptable impact resistance make it a pragmatic choice for mass production. Consider the daily rider, navigating urban landscapes, where minor scrapes and bumps are unavoidable. An ABS cowl provides a degree of resilience, absorbing impacts that might otherwise damage more fragile materials. However, ABS lacks the stiffness and weight-saving properties sought by performance-oriented riders.
-
Carbon Fiber: The Pursuit of Lightness
Carbon fiber embodies the ultimate expression of weight reduction and strength. The intricate weave of carbon fibers, bonded with resin, creates a structure that is significantly lighter and stiffer than ABS. Picture a track day enthusiast, meticulously shaving every gram from their S1000RR. A carbon fiber cowl offers a tangible advantage, reducing unsprung weight and potentially improving handling responsiveness. However, the cost of carbon fiber is substantially higher, making it a premium option reserved for those prioritizing performance above all else. Moreover, carbon fiber is more susceptible to damage from sharp impacts, requiring careful handling.
-
Fiberglass: The Affordable Alternative
Fiberglass, a composite material consisting of glass fibers embedded in a resin matrix, offers a compromise between ABS and carbon fiber. It is lighter than ABS but heavier than carbon fiber, and it provides a reasonable level of strength at a more affordable price point. Imagine a rider seeking an upgrade from the stock passenger seat but unwilling to commit to the expense of carbon fiber. A fiberglass cowl presents a viable option, offering a noticeable weight reduction and improved aesthetics without breaking the bank. However, fiberglass can be more brittle than ABS and carbon fiber, making it prone to cracking under stress.
-
Paint and Finish: The Final Touches
Regardless of the underlying material, the paint and finish play a crucial role in the overall appearance and durability of the seat cowl. A high-quality paint job, meticulously matched to the S1000RR’s factory color, ensures seamless integration with the motorcycle’s existing bodywork. Envision a rider who values attention to detail. A poorly matched paint color or uneven finish can detract from the motorcycle’s aesthetic appeal, negating the benefits of the cowl. Furthermore, a durable clear coat protects the underlying paint from scratches, UV damage, and other environmental hazards, ensuring that the cowl retains its pristine appearance for years to come.
The selection of material for the BMW S1000RR is a strategic decision. ABS provides affordable durability, carbon fiber offers unparalleled lightness, fiberglass offers a budget-friendly alternative and all materials need a perfect paint and finish that harmonizes performance and looks. Each material speaks to a different set of priorities, defining the balance between cost, performance, and aesthetic ambition.

Frequently Asked Questions
Navigating the world of aftermarket accessories for a high-performance machine such as the BMW S1000RR can present challenges. The following questions address common concerns surrounding the selection, installation, and implications of installing a seat cowl.
Question 1: Will installing a seat cowl void the motorcycle’s warranty?
The specter of warranty voidance looms large when contemplating modifications to a new motorcycle. In general, installing a seat cowl alone is unlikely to invalidate the entire warranty. However, if the installation process damages other components, or if the cowl itself contributes to a failure, related warranty claims may be denied. Consult the specific terms of the BMW warranty and seek clarification from a qualified dealer before proceeding.
Question 2: How does a seat cowl affect the motorcycle’s handling?
The BMW S1000RR exists as a precisely balanced machine. The replacement of the passenger seat with a seat cowl does affect the bike’s weight distribution and aerodynamics. Many would ask if these minimal changes truly influence the handling. While subtle, some riders report that solo configurations improve high-speed stability and cornering responsiveness. But, these effects are often overshadowed by rider skill and suspension settings. It is necessary to consider that the handling improvements are not drastically influenced.
Question 3: Are all seat cowls created equal in terms of quality?
In the marketplace of aftermarket parts, varying degrees of quality coexist. Some cowls are crafted from high-grade materials with precision molding and flawless paint, while others fall short. Lower-quality cowls may exhibit fitment issues, flimsy construction, and poor color matching. Investing in a reputable brand or a cowl with documented positive reviews mitigates this risk.
Question 4: Can a seat cowl be easily removed and reinstalled?
The ease of removal and reinstallation depends on the design and mounting mechanism of the specific seat cowl. Some cowls utilize a simple latching system, enabling quick transitions between solo and passenger configurations. Others require tools and a more involved process. Before purchasing, assess the mounting system and determine whether it aligns with the anticipated frequency of seat cowl removal.
Question 5: What is the ideal material for a seat cowl: ABS plastic or carbon fiber?
The choice between ABS plastic and carbon fiber hinges on priorities. ABS plastic offers a balance of affordability and durability, while carbon fiber prioritizes weight reduction and aesthetic appeal. Carbon fiber is susceptible to damage from impacts. ABS is a practical choice for daily use, while carbon fiber may appeal to those seeking the ultimate performance enhancement.
Question 6: How can a proper color match between the seat cowl and the motorcycle be ensured?
Achieving a flawless color match is essential for visual harmony. Providing the paint code when ordering, is an important step. Some manufacturers guarantee color matching based on the paint code, while others may require a sample for reference. Consider consulting with a professional paint shop for custom matching. Essential Considerations
Selecting a seat cowl for the BMW S1000RR transcends mere aesthetics; it is an exercise in informed decision-making. The path is strewn with potential pitfalls, demanding vigilance and a discerning eye. Consider the cautionary tales of those who ventured forth unprepared.
Tip 1: Temper Expectations Regarding Aerodynamic Gains: Marketingspeak often exaggerates the aerodynamic advantages conferred by a seat cowl. While smoothing airflow is a valid concept, realize that any tangible performance increase is likely to be marginal on public roads. Prioritize fit, finish, and overall aesthetic harmony over unsubstantiated claims of enhanced speed.
Tip 2: Scrutinize Paint Matching Claims with Extreme Caution: Achieving a flawless color match to the S1000RR’s factory paint is notoriously difficult. View manufacturer guarantees with skepticism. Request high-resolution photographs under various lighting conditions before committing to a purchase. Be prepared for the possibility of needing professional paintwork to achieve a satisfactory result.
Tip 3: Resist the Temptation of Unbranded Bargains: The allure of a deeply discounted seat cowl can be strong, but exercise restraint. Unbranded or suspiciously cheap options often compromise on material quality, fitment accuracy, and overall durability. A poorly fitting cowl can damage the motorcycle’s bodywork, negating any initial cost savings.
Tip 4: Verify Compatibility with Existing Accessories: The S1000RR’s tail section can be a crowded space, particularly if aftermarket taillights, turn signals, or fender eliminator kits are already installed. Confirm that the chosen seat cowl is compatible with these accessories before proceeding. Incompatibility can necessitate modifications or the replacement of existing parts.
Tip 5: Document the Unboxing and Initial Inspection: Upon receiving the seat cowl, meticulously document the unboxing process with photographs and videos. Thoroughly inspect the part for any defects, scratches, or shipping damage. This documentation will prove invaluable in the event of a return or warranty claim.
Tip 6: Retain the Original Passenger Seat and Hardware: Even if solo riding is the primary focus, retain the original passenger seat and mounting hardware. Circumstances may arise where the passenger seat is required, such as for resale purposes or occasional passenger transport. Proper storage will ensure the seat remains in good condition.
